The lumbar area (lower back) naturally slopes inward. Sitting for long periods without sufficient support can cause this curve to flatten, resulting in discomfort and poor posture. A chair with built-in lumbar support helps keep the spine in its natural posture, relieving pressure on the lower back and weariness during extended work hours.

Look for amenities like adjustable seat height, lumbar support, reclining capability, and adjustable armrests. Breathable fabrics and a well-cushioned seat also help to maintain comfort throughout the day.
Combining an ergonomic chair with the appropriate desk height and monitor location improves posture and relieves pressure on your neck and shoulders.
